The link between mental health and pain is often neglected and has only recently emerged a subject of interest. Nevertheless, these two aspects are very important in the day-to-day practice of physicians. This book will serve as an innovative tool presenting psychiatric disorders such as major depression, schizophrenia, addiction, autism etc… Hence it is dedicated to general practitioners, psychiatrists, pain physicians, palliative healing caregivers, nurses, kinesitherapists, physiotherapists, ergotherapists, psychomotricians, researchers and medicine students. The contributing authors are all internationally respected experts in their field.
Preface.- Introduction.- History - the myths....- Neurophysiological bases of pain.- Pain perception in mental health.- Epidemiology of chronic pain in mental health: the example of depression.- Depression, bipolar disorder, and pain.- Anxiety disorders and pain.- Schizophrenia and pain.- Somatoform disorders and pain.- Post traumatic stress disorder and pain.- Pain in suicidal ideation.- Pain in children with autism.- Addiction and pain.- Pain assessment in mental health.- Treatment and therapeutic perspectives.
